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 15 mins
Total Time: 25 mins
Cuisine: American
Serves: 4 servings

Ingredients

  1. 1 head cauliflower, chopped
  2. 1 onion, chopped
  3. 2 cloves garlic, minced
  4. 4 cups vegetable broth
  5. 1 cup heavy cream
  6. 1 tsp smoked paprika
  7.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Prepare ingredients by washing and chopping cauliflower into medium-sized florets, finely dice the onion, and mince the garlic cloves.
  2. Turn on the Instant Pot and select the Sauté function. Add a small amount of olive oil and sauté the chopped onions until they become translucent and slightly golden, approximately 3-4 minutes.
  3. Add minced garlic to the onions and cook for an additional 30 seconds, stirring continuously to prevent burning and release aromatic flavors.
  4. Add chopped cauliflower florets to the Instant Pot and stir to combine with onions and garlic.
  5. Pour vegetable broth into the pot, ensuring all cauliflower is mostly submerged. Sprinkle smoked paprika, salt, and pepper over the mixture.
  6. Close the Instant Pot lid, set the valve to sealing position, and select the Manual/Pressure Cook function for 5 minutes at high pressure.
  7. Once cooking cycle completes, perform a quick release of pressure by carefully turning the valve to venting position.
  8. Use an immersion blender to puree the soup directly in the Instant Pot until smooth and creamy, or carefully transfer to a standard blender in batches.
  9. Stir in heavy cream, adjusting seasoning with additional salt and pepper as needed.
  10. Serve hot, optionally garnishing with extra smoked paprika, chopped chives, or crispy bacon bits.

Tips

  1. Choose a fresh, firm cauliflower head for the best texture and flavor.
  2. Don't skip the sautéing step – it develops deep, rich flavors that make this soup extraordinary.
  3. Use an immersion blender for the easiest and most mess-free blending experience.
  4. For extra richness, you can substitute half-and-half or whole milk if heavy cream is too rich.
  5. The smoked paprika is key to the soup's unique flavor profile – don't substitute with regular paprika.
  6. If you want a lighter version, you can use coconut milk instead of heavy cream.
  7. For added protein, consider topping with crispy bacon bits or roasted chickpeas.
  8. Always do a quick pressure release to prevent overcooking the cauliflower.
  9. Taste and adjust seasonings after blending to ensure perfect flavor balance.
  10. This soup can be stored in the refrigerator for 3-4 days, making it perfect for meal prep.
